'Hugh will never marry'
11/01/2006 13:51 - (SA)
London - British model and actress Liz Hurley has poured scorn on rumours that her former lover, the actor Hugh Grant, would tie the knot with Jemima Khan, the ex-wife of the Pakistani politician and former cricketer Imran Khan.
Hurley, 40, who dated Grant for 13 years before they split up in 2000, said the actor and Khan had no plans to marry.
"I don't see him as much these days, but I do know that he's not getting married either, even though that has been written about in the newspapers", she told Grazia magazine.
"I think I would know if he was and I do know that he isn't."
Hurley and Khan, the 31-year-old heiress daughter of the late millionaire Sir James Goldsmith, are known to have frosty relations.
Grant's continued feelings for Hurley have been blamed for undermining his 18-month relationship with Khan, who has two sons with her former husband.
Hurley, meanwhile, rejected rumours that she was planning to marry her boyfriend, the Indian millionaire businessman Arun Nayar.
Reports that she was going to get married to Nayar in February were a "myth", said Hurley.
Like Grant, she would not get married, said Hurley.
"We are absolutely not getting married. It's a complete and utter myth", said Hurley.
About Grant, she added: "He's a big part of my life and it hasn't been a problem with Arun. Hugh is my best friend and I can't imagine life without him." -Sapa-dpa
